    The OG SnapDragon... Now that would be a serious bit of engineering to convert it over to BF, what a silly design with the reverse threaded base and Rose V2 style positive plate.

    The original e-Phoenix Resurrection was enough for me, but I did manage to drill a straight hole up through that solid centerpost. ;)
    Tell me about it. The answer was a long bf pin (I think it was goon lp legnth). Drilled through the base and contact disc centrally and then the chamber deck. The hole in the chamber and disk had to be slightly larger and I used nyloc, (liquid hard setting nylon that's heat proof) to make a spacer in that gap between deck and pin to prevent short.
    It was definitely a thinker but I grabbed a load of the clones and made a few for friends.
